Warmed up the car this morning, with remote start, while I was getting ready for work... which is 15 minutes of run time. Timer ran out, and the car shut down. Get into the car maybe 10 minutes later and try to start it... nothing. Engine turns over fine, sounds perfectly normal in terms of any mechanical issues.

Started going through troubleshooting... codes are fine, checked all the connections to vital sensors and switches... all are fine. Switched over to Hydra to see if it would at least start... nothing. At this point started to suspect the fuel pump Pressure in the fuel line post fuel filter is not there, I can squeeze the line with my hand... Pressure pre-fuel filter is also the same... non-existent... So... I guess the SVX throws yet another curve ball at me.

Fuel tank is at 95% capacity... and as far as I know replacing the fuel pump requires an empty tank, any suggestions on how to drain the tank and perform this fix out of a parking lot?

Kirill,

The fuel pump is easily accessed through the silver plate (4 philips head screws) in your floor behind your rear seat, under the trunk carpet. You do not need an empty tank.
